The 1.5SMC160A-M3/9AT belongs to the category of surface mount transient voltage suppressor (TVS) diodes.
It is primarily used for surge protection in electronic circuits and systems, safeguarding against transient overvoltage conditions.
The 1.5SMC160A-M3/9AT is typically available in a DO-214AB (SMC) package.
The essence of this product lies in its ability to provide robust protection against transient voltage spikes, ensuring the integrity of sensitive electronic components.
These diodes are commonly packaged in reels or trays, with quantities varying based on manufacturer specifications.
The 1.5SMC160A-M3/9AT typically features two pins for surface mounting onto circuit boards. The pin configuration follows standard SMC diode layout.
When subjected to a transient overvoltage event, the 1.5SMC160A-M3/9AT rapidly conducts excess current away from the protected circuit, limiting the voltage across it to a safe level.
The 1.5SMC160A-M3/9AT finds application in various industries including: - Telecommunications - Automotive electronics - Industrial automation - Consumer electronics
In conclusion, the 1.5SMC160A-M3/9AT TVS diode offers reliable surge protection for a wide range of electronic applications, making it an essential component in safeguarding sensitive circuits against transient voltage events.
